How to realize serial communication through PHP and RS232 protocol
Overview:
Nowadays, serial communication is widely used in many fields, such as industrial automation, communication equipment, etc. This article will introduce how to use PHP language to communicate with the serial port through the RS232 protocol, and provide relevant code examples.
Introduction to RS232 protocol:
RS232 protocol is a commonly used serial communication protocol, which defines the standards for the physical layer and data link layer of serial communication. Through the RS232 protocol, we can transmit data between the computer and external devices, such as sensors, PLC, etc.
How PHP communicates with RS232:
To use PHP language to communicate with the serial port, we need to use the PHP extension library php_serial. php_serial is an open source extension library that encapsulates the serial communication function into a PHP class library.
The steps are as follows:
- Make sure the system supports serial port communication
Before using php_serial, you must first ensure that the system's serial port device is working properly. You can use the terminal commandls /dev/tty*
to view the serial devices available in the system. -
Install the php_serial extension library
You can install the php_serial extension library through the following command:sudo apt-get install php-pear sudo pecl install channel://pecl.php.net/php_serial
After the installation is completed, you need to add the following configuration to php.ini:
extension=php_serial.so
-
Introduce the php_serial class and create the serial port object
In the PHP code, we can introduce the php_serial class through the require_once keyword and create the SerialPort object:require_once('php_serial.class.php'); $serial = new phpSerial;
-
Set serial port parameters
Before communicating with the serial port, you need to set the parameters of the serial port, such as baud rate, data bits, parity, etc. You can use setPort, setParity, setDataBits and other methods to set the serial port parameters:$serial->setPort("/dev/ttyUSB0"); $serial->setBaudRate(9600); //设置波特率为9600 $serial->setParity("none"); $serial->setDataBits(8); $serial->setStopBits(1); $serial->setFlowControl("none");
-
Open the serial port
After setting the serial port parameters, you can open the serial port through the open method:$serial->open();
-
Read and write serial port data
The data received by the serial port can be read through the readPort method:$read_data = $serial->readPort();
The data can be sent to the serial port through the writePort method:
$serial->writePort("Hello World!");
-
Close the serial port
After the communication is completed, remember to close the serial port:$serial->close();
The complete PHP code example is as follows:
require_once('php_serial.class.php'); $serial = new phpSerial; $serial->setPort("/dev/ttyUSB0"); $serial->setBaudRate(9600); $serial->setParity("none"); $serial->setDataBits(8); $serial->setStopBits(1); $serial->setFlowControl("none"); $serial->open(); $serial->writePort("Hello World!"); $read_data = $serial->readPort(); $serial->close();
It should be noted that the serial port communication is in Linux It is slightly different from the implementation in Windows systems and can be adjusted accordingly according to the system type.

In PHP, weak references are implemented through the WeakReference class and will not prevent the garbage collector from reclaiming objects. Weak references are suitable for scenarios such as caching systems and event listeners. It should be noted that it cannot guarantee the survival of objects and that garbage collection may be delayed.
